What Is The New MVP Plastic In The Jeremy Koling Signing Video? 🥏✨

As if signing Jeremy Koling wasn't exciting enough. Just MVP doing MVP things I guess.🙄

The new MVP plastic teased at the end of the Big Jerm signing video looks too good to be true! Footage showed discs with what appeared to be glow-in-the-dark specs inside the plastic of the core.

If that is the case MVP could be about to hit another home run with a very unique plastic on the disc golf market.

Update: Jeremy Kolings new Team Series Tempo just dropped, and it's in the new plastic! This plastic is called Particle Glow. It's made with a Proton core, and flakes of Eclipse 2.0 glow plastic.

 

 

What Is The Core Plastic?

The plastic used for the core of these discs was very clear, putting the glow speckles on full display. I may be wrong but it seems fairly likely that the core plastic is Proton, or something similar.

 

3 MVP discs in the new sparkle glow plastic

 

Proton is a translucent and durable premium plastic. Prism Proton is a variation that incorporates shimmery flakes into the plastic, so it's clear that something like glowing flakes could be possible.

 

What Are Those Glowing Spots In The Core?

The question really is, what are those glowing spots? Could it be tiny pieces of MVP's Eclipse 2.0 plastic, or is it something entirely new?

 

close up of the glowing speckles in the new MVP plastic

 

Another possibility would be small flakes that react to a black light. If you watch the video carefully it does look like a UV light is being shone onto the discs. You can see a purplish reflection at times.
